What is white discharge and Why It Needs Attention?
White discharge, or leukorrhea, is the normal secretion of fluid from the vagina. While generally harmless, changes in colour, consistency, odour, or amount can indicate an underlying infection or condition. Common Causes of white discharge
The most frequent primary cause of white discharge: Fungal infections like candidiasis (yeast infection) are a common culprit, thriving in warm, moist environments.
The most common secondary cause of white discharge: Bacterial vaginosis (BV), an imbalance of bacteria in the vagina, often leads to a noticeable discharge.
An important lifestyle or environmental trigger for white discharge: Poor hygiene practices, especially during menstruation, and the use of harsh soaps or douches can disrupt the vaginal pH balance and trigger abnormal discharge.
Symptoms of white discharge That Need Medical Attention
The most concerning symptom of white discharge: A strong, foul odour accompanying the discharge, potentially signalling a bacterial infection or sexually transmitted infection (STI).
A symptom indicating the condition is worsening: Itching, burning, or redness in the vaginal area, indicating irritation and potentially an infection that requires prompt attention.
A symptom that requires immediate medical help: Pelvic pain, fever, or bleeding between periods, suggesting a more serious underlying condition like pelvic inflammatory disease (PID).
Diagnosing white discharge and When to Seek Medical Help
Diagnosing the cause of white discharge involves a thorough medical history and physical examination by a healthcare professional. Your doctor will likely inquire about the characteristics of the discharge (colour, odour, consistency), your menstrual cycle, sexual history, and any associated symptoms. A pelvic exam allows the doctor to visually inspect the vagina and cervix. A sample of the discharge may be taken for laboratory analysis to identify the presence of bacteria, fungi, or other pathogens. You should seek medical help if the discharge changes in colour or odour, is accompanied by itching, burning, pelvic pain, or fever, or if you have concerns about an STI. white discharge Treatments and Remedies
Medical treatments: Treatment for abnormal white discharge depends on the underlying cause. Fungal infections are usually treated with antifungal creams, suppositories, or oral medications. Bacterial vaginosis is typically treated with antibiotics. Sexually transmitted infections require specific antibiotic or antiviral treatment. Your doctor may also prescribe medication to manage symptoms such as itching or pain. Medicas can help you find the best Treatment for white discharge in Greams Road.
Home remedies: Maintaining good hygiene is crucial. Wash the vaginal area gently with mild soap and water, and avoid using harsh soaps, douches, or scented products that can disrupt the natural pH balance. Wearing breathable cotton underwear can help reduce moisture and prevent infections. A balanced diet rich in probiotics may also support vaginal health.
Lifestyle changes: Practicing safe sex, including using condoms, can help prevent STIs that cause abnormal discharge. Avoid douching, as it can disrupt the natural balance of bacteria in the vagina. Promptly change out of wet swimwear or workout clothes to prevent fungal growth.
